Get Healthy U TV is versatile and convenient. Here are some other things we LOVE about it…

  • Variety: Choose from barre, yoga, kickboxing, and more (no equipment needed).
  • Expert Instructors: Professional trainers make every class easy to follow.
  • Live Sessions: Get real-time notifications for live workouts.
  • No Ads: Enjoy uninterrupted workouts, yes, even during 40-minute sessions!
  • Device Flexibility: Stream on your phone, tablet, or smart TV and work out anywhere!

  1. Summer

    How hard is cancellation? I see it automatically renews.

    • Amber (Hip Sidekick)

      Great question, Summer! You can cancel anytime before your year ends. Just contact customer service at 1-844-278-2050 or editor@gethealthyutv.com. ❤️🤗

      • Melissa

        You can also do it online. When you log into your account, just click on the icon in the upper right corner (it’s a circle with your initials). Go to “membership.” There you will see “automatic renewal” and you can just toggle it to “off.” It was easy peasy for me.
